Giving Profile

In 2023, Call to Action Foundation based in UT paid 5 grants totaling $76K to 5 organizations. Individual grants ranged from $1K to $40K, with a median of $5K. Its largest recipients included UTAH FOUNDATION, THE CENTER FOR ECONOMIC OPPORTUNITY AND BELONGING, and RONALD MCDONALD HOUSE CHARITIES. The foundation does not accept unsolicited applications — giving is by invitation only.
